Why should you train your employees?
Knowledge Retention: Some employees might require refresher courses or training for their job function that they might have forgotten, or new programs could have become available to enhance their skill set. When employees are given the tools they need to succeed, they are more likely to retain that knowledge and apply it when needed. This leads to increased productivity and better results for the company.
Reduced or no supervision required: Once employees have the necessary training and development; they would be able to function without any supervision. This frees up their managers’ time to focus on strategy and other important matters.
Employee Morale: Training and development is a critical part of a company’s success. It can help employees feel more confident in their jobs and make them feel that they are growing. This helps to improve employee morale, which can lead to increased productivity.
Employee turnover: Modern employees tend to job hop and the result is inadequate career development opportunities. As employees grow more comfortable with the way their company operates, they will be more likely to stay on board longer if they are provided with opportunities to learn new skills.
Supports business culture: Training and development helps employees develop skills in the workplace. This helps them to be more productive and improves their relationship with their colleagues as they interact more with each other, share ideas and learn from others. Any business that wants to succeed must ensure that it has a strong culture, which is essential for its growth.
